Key Features That Define a Great Online Sports Betting Platform
Every serious bettor or even casual participant knows that not all online sports betting sites are the same. The differences may not be obvious at first glance, especially when nearly every site markets itself with big bonuses, sleek layouts, and a wide range of sports options. But a closer look reveals what really separates the best from the rest. First, platform usability is essential. A cluttered interface, confusing navigation, or lagging site speed can turn a good betting opportunity into a frustrating experience. A well-designed site will let users place bets quickly, access betting history, and switch between live games and upcoming events without delay. Then comes the variety of markets. Beyond traditional match outcomes, top platforms offer options like in-play betting, combination bets, handicaps, over/under markets, and player performance props. This variety appeals to different types of bettors, from strategic analysts to thrill-seekers. Live betting is another major component. The ability to bet during a match with continuously updated odds creates an immersive environment, especially when paired with live match data or streaming. However, all these features are meaningless without security. A great betting site uses advanced encryption to protect user data, provides multiple secure payment options, and ensures that financial withdrawals are processed fairly and on time. Another differentiator is responsible gaming support. Features like setting deposit limits, self-exclusion options, and account activity tracking show that a site is committed to user well-being. Customer service also speaks volumes—having fast, knowledgeable support available via multiple channels, including chat and email, can make all the difference. And finally, transparency in terms and conditions, bonus requirements, and payout timelines builds the trust that keeps users coming back.
Why Reputation and Regulation Matter in Online Sports Betting
The online sports betting industry is booming, and with that growth comes an influx of both legitimate operators and risky imitators. In this landscape, the importance of a site’s reputation and regulatory framework cannot be overstated. Reputable online sports betting sites operate under licenses from respected jurisdictions like the UK Gambling Commission, Malta Gaming Authority, or other well-known regulatory bodies. These licenses aren’t just symbolic—they require operators to comply with strict standards around fairness, security, and dispute resolution. A site with such a license must maintain fairness in its odds, offer secure banking, and provide a reliable system for handling complaints. Moreover, licensed sites are regularly audited by third parties to verify their integrity. This gives users confidence that they aren’t being manipulated or scammed. Reputation, on the other hand, comes from consistency. A site that processes withdrawals quickly, honors promotions, and treats users fairly will naturally earn strong word-of-mouth and user reviews. Community feedback—on forums, review platforms, or even social media—can be an early indicator of a site's trustworthiness or hidden issues. For example, patterns of unresolved complaints, account bans without reason, or sudden changes in payout terms should be taken seriously. Users should also be cautious of sites that promise extremely high bonuses with vague requirements. These are often tactics used by low-trust operators to lure users in.
